KFC is a mastodon in the country. So far, their growth has been with low prices and affordable specials (with average meals around 7-15USD) since post-covid (they were one of the few franchises that didn't struggle during covid times) ... but their quality has been a downturn for many Dominicans in urban areas ever since. And Dominicans when it goes to flavors and quality, they do really notice.

Btw, all of sudden, KFC started triggering last minute deals (35% off) since Popeyes opened.


This will be a little battle between the two for a couple of months.

i am surprised they're already on pedidos ya without mastering their in-person service. I went at 10:30, they opened at 11 on Sunday. The workers arrived at the same time i did?
There were already a long line of cars at the drive-thru.
By 11, there was at least 150 people there.
Then none of the registers work, they had to go and tell the people who had been in line all morning at the drive thru that they had to come in.
They opened 30 minutes late and served food at 11:45.

But the food was good. For some reason, i do feel like they pay closer to attention to quality control at American fast food restaurants here than in the states.
